Civic Life

For a town its size, Jacksonport teems with civic-minded residents who devote time, labor and expertise in service to the community.

Visitors who flock to Jacksonport’s premier event — Maifest — have no idea how many people contribute to the planning and operation of the Memorial Day tradition. Long before the first brats hit the grill, dozens of townspeople deal with the logistics of lining up entertainment, setting up the arts and crafts fair and organizing the parade.

Our other major events — Cherry Fest, the Thanksgiving Day benefit parade and the Polar Bear Club plunge — depend on volunteer helpers.

Whenever a need arises, townspeople step up — clearing fallen trees after a storm, planting flowers at the park and gathering donations for the needy, to name just a few charitable acts commonplace in Jacksonport.
